Skip to content
GitLab
Projects
Groups
Snippets
Help
Loading...
Help
Help
Support
Keyboard shortcuts
?
Submit feedback
Sign in
Toggle navigation
M
mice_amr_2021
Project overview
Project overview
Details
Activity
Releases
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Locked Files
Issues
0
Issues
0
List
Boards
Labels
Service Desk
Milestones
Merge Requests
0
Merge Requests
0
Requirements
Requirements
List
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Security & Compliance
Security & Compliance
Dependency List
License Compliance
Operations
Operations
Metrics
Environments
Packages & Registries
Packages & Registries
Package Registry
Container Registry
Analytics
Analytics
CI / CD
Code Review
Insights
Issue
Repository
Value Stream
Wiki
Wiki
External Wiki
External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
Susheel Busi
mice_amr_2021
Commits
23bc1268
Commit
23bc1268
authored
Apr 20, 2021
by
Laura Denies
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
Add new file
parent
8e8ee848
Changes
1
Hide whitespace changes
Inline
Side-by-side
Showing
1 changed file
with
32 additions
and
0 deletions
+32
-0
Integron_Prediction/Snakefile
Integron_Prediction/Snakefile
+32
-0
No files found.
Integron_Prediction/Snakefile
0 → 100644
View file @
23bc1268
# Predict Integrons
configfile: "config.yaml"
rule all:
input: expand(["{datadir}/{project}/{sample}.attc.adj.txt", "{datadir}/{project}/{sample}.intI.txt","{datadir}/{project}/{sample}_integron_prediction.tsv"], datadir=config["integrons"]["datadir"], project=config["integrons"]["project"], sample=config["integrons"]["sample"])
rule attC:
input: "{datadir}/{sample}.fna"
output: "{datadir}/{project}/{sample}.attc.txt", "{datadir}/{project}/{sample}.attc.adj.txt"
shell: """
export PATH={config[integrons][HattCI]}:$PATH
hattci.out {input} {output[0]}
sed -i -n '/--------------------------------------------/q;p' {output[0]}
cut -f 2,5 -d$'\t' {output[0]} > {output[1]}
"""
rule intI:
input: "{datadir}/{sample}.fna"
output: "{datadir}/{project}/{sample}.intI.txt"
conda: "hmm.yaml"
shell: "nhmmscan --noali --notextw --tblout {output} hmm_model_integron/intI.hmm {input}"
rule Integrons:
input:
attc="{datadir}/{project}/{sample}.attc.adj.txt",
intI="{datadir}/{project}/{sample}.intI.txt"
output: Integrons="{datadir}/{project}/{sample}_integron_prediction.tsv"
conda: "R.yaml"
script: "Integron.R"
\ No newline at end of file
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ment